Description

A kind of EC centrifugal fans low noise cooling tower
Technical field
The utility model is related to cooling tower, and in particular to a kind of centrifugal fan low noise cooling tower.
Background technology
Cooling tower is, as circulating coolant, heat dissipation to be absorbed from a system into air, to reduce water temperature with water Device;It is to carry out cold and hot exchange after contacting with air flow using water to produce steam that its is cold, and steam volatilization is taken away heat and reached The principles such as evaporative heat loss, convection heat transfer' heat-transfer by convection and radiant heat transfer reduce water temperature to disperse the waste heat produced in industrial or refrigeration air-conditioner Evaporating radiator, to ensure the normal operation of system.Blower fan in mechanical-draft cooling tower is the core component of cooling tower One of, the cooling capacity of the good and bad direct relation complete machine of its performance, mechanical-draft cooling tower typically all uses axial fan.
Utility model content
Technical problem to be solved in the utility model is to be directed to the above-mentioned state of the art, and provides a kind of EC centrifugal fans Low noise cooling tower, its EC centrifugal fan is the centrifugal fan using digitlization brushless direct-current external rotor electric machine.
The utility model solve the technical scheme that is used of above-mentioned technical problem for:
A kind of EC centrifugal fans low noise cooling tower, including cooling shell, EC centrifugal fans, water collection device, water distribution Pipe, filler, water inlet pipe, outlet pipe, blow-off pipe, air-inlet window, it is characterised in that:The EC centrifugal fans are arranged at outside cooling tower The top of shell, the bottom of the cooling tower shell side is provided with outlet pipe, water distributor, blow-off pipe, the blow-off pipe and moisturizing Pipe is disposed in parallel in the one end at cooling shell base angle.The another side of the cooling shell is provided with air-inlet window, for the external world Air can be supplemented into cooling tower in time, and filler, water distributor and water collection device are provided with the cooling tower, and the filler, which is fixed, to be put It is placed on the stuffing frame in cooling tower, the water distributor is set in parallel in above filler, after blower fan is opened, the air-inlet window is inhaled The air entered first by filler, then after water collection device and blower fan from cooling tower top discharge.The water distributor is used for fanman Recirculated water is passed into and is uniformly arranged in after cooling tower spray head on filler when making, and the recirculated water is flowed into after filler by air Cooling falls into the base that catchments, then by outlet pipe into cooling device is needed, so circulation.
Further, the EC centrifugal fans employ digitlization brushless direct-current external rotor electric machine, and in rotor On install centrifugal fan additional.
Further, the EC centrifugal fans use permanent magnet excitation, eliminate the generation of induction machine exciting current Loss, compared to the axial flow blower commonly driven by threephase asynchronous, with higher efficiency;Other brshless DC motor Excitation field does not need the reactive current of power network, therefore its power factor is far above induction machine, and brshless DC motor can be transported Row is in 1 power factor, and this is extremely advantageous to low-power machine.Brushless electric machine compared with induction machine not only nominal load when have Higher efficiency and power factor, and it is more advantageous in underloading.
Further, not only speed regulating control is simple for the EC centrifugal fans brshless DC motor, and with more preferable Speed adjusting performance, therefore cooling tower has abandoned common gear reduction unit, belt reducer.
The beneficial effects of the utility model are:Compared to conventional one cooling tower, the cooling of this EC centrifugal fans low noise The small, power factor of tower loss is high, simple in construction, easy to control, and operation noise is low.
